Hazard vs. Near Miss
Hazard - An act or a condition in the workplace
that has the potential to cause injury,
illness, or death to a person and/or
damage to company property, equipment
and materials
Near Miss - is an unplanned event that did not
result in injury, illness, or damage – but
had the potential to do so. Only a
fortunate break in the chain of events
prevented an injury, fatality or damage

Risk vs. Hazard
Risk: The measure of the
probability and severity of
an adverse effect caused by
a hazard
Hazard: What causes the
risk; administrative or
physical (causes or has the
potential to cause a loss)
